ZIP 60469 and ZIP 60474 are ZIP Code areas in Illinois.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 60469 has the higher population (5,295 vs 628 in ZIP 60474). ZIP 60474 has the higher median household income ($86,250 vs $72,041 in ZIP 60469). ZIP 60469 has the higher median home value ($173,900 vs $166,200 in ZIP 60474).
